No, it would not work. Think of it this way, when using air, the ball accelerates to 300 fps in 7", if you tried accelerating the ball with the bolt alone, it would have to accelerate in about 0.5" to 300 fps. Unfeasable, unless you use a very long bolt so that you can accelerate the ball over a greater distance. There's a whole number of reasons why it wouldn't work. Blah Blah Blah,
